Religiously unaffiliated voters now 29 percent of U.S. adults

The share of Americans identifying as religiously unaffiliated reached 29 percent in recent data, surpassing Catholics and evangelical Protestants. Campaigns report higher per-voter costs to contact this group because it lacks centralized networks.

Polling Shows Shift Among Suburban and Independent Voters

Recent polling indicates changes in support among suburban, college-educated and independent voters ahead of the November elections. The data comes from multiple national surveys conducted in recent weeks. These groups have been key to outcomes in prior presidential races.
